Abstract
A drug delivery device, including a body (104, 116) having a reservoir (160) disposed therein for containing a medicament and an injection needle (152) for penetrating the skin of a patient, the needle (152) providing a path for the medicament between the reservoir (160) and the patient. The device also includes a rotor (580) rotatably disposed in the body (104, 116) for activating the device upon rotation of the rotor (580), a needle cover (112) for covering the injection needle, and a needle cover clip (560) disposed on the needle cover (112) to rotate from a first position preventing rotor rotation to a second position permitting rotor rotation.

4. A drug delivery device, comprising:
-
a body having a reservoir disposed therein for containing a medicament; an injection needle for penetrating the skin of a patient, the needle providing a path for the medicament between the reservoir and the patient; a needle cover having a first portion for covering the injection needle and a second portion movable from a first position preventing device activation to a second position enabling device activation; and a rotor disposed in the body to move from a pre-activated position to an activated position to activate the device; wherein; the second portion of the needle cover engages the rotor to prevent the rotor from moving to the activated position; the rotor has an engagement slot; the second portion of the needle cover comprises a lockout pin for engaging the engagement slot through an opening in the device body to prevent device activation; the second portion of the needle cover comprises a needle cover clip rotatably disposed on the first portion of the needle cover; and the lockout pin is disposed on the needle cover clip. - View Dependent Claims (5)
